Those who would like to take their loved one into the room without a completed sensory profile will have the opportunity to do so. However, please be aware that the resident may not have been assessed by the Music Therapy or Recreation Therapy Department Supervisors and, therefore, there may be a possibility some residents could find the environment overstimulating. It will be at the family’s discretion to bring them into the room.
To ensure a safe experience for all:
Before entering the room, please sanitize your hands and the resident’s hands.
Residents must always be accompanied and supervised by a family member, friend, or companion during their visit. Residents should never be left alone in the room.
Depending on busyness, please keep visits to 20 minutes to allow time for others. Please monitor your own time in the room.
A maximum of six people are allowed in the room at once. Of those six, we request no more than two wheelchairs in the room at one time to prevent overcrowding and ensure flow of the room.
Food and drinks are NOT permitted in the room.
Please do not remove any items from the room and leave it as you found it.
